On 12/02/2014 02:28 AM, Erik Auerswald wrote: > Hi, > > On Mon, Dec 01, 2014 at 11:12:51AM -0700, Eric Blake wrote: >> On 12/01/2014 10:56 AM, Chema F. Ledesma wrote: >>> >>> If you execute echo "!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!" it does something strange >>> repeating the last command before echo comand. >> >> Thanks for the report. However, this is not a bug in 'echo', but a >> feature of your shell. > > And because of this you can use single quotes instead of double quotes to > print those exclamation marks: > > $ echo '!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!' > !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Or turn off history expansion: $ set +o history $ echo "!!!!" !!!! -- Eric Blake eblake redhat com +1-919-301-3266 Libvirt virtualization library http://libvirt.org
